Q: What do I do when a visitor arrives unannounced?

A: Check the Marletta visitor log. No booking, no entry — ask them to wait in the lobby while you contact the host. If the host confirms, issue a day sticker and escort them through the side gate using the pass below.

staff pass of yajef-kajog = bdg-TPF-7

Handover note — Crumbwheel order cutoffs.

Welcome aboard. The bakery cutoff rule in Crumbwheel closes same-day orders at 14:00 local to each storefront, not UTC — this has bitten us twice. Holiday overrides live in the calendar service and take precedence silently, so always check there first when a cutoff looks wrong. To unlock the calendar service's admin console after a restart, enter the recovery passphrase below.

vault phrase of bagap-bahaf = silion-pelox-sorox-casdor-quenwyn-fraax-eliox-praael-kelion-quenvan-kasox-rusael-norius-belvan

**Q: What happens when Mailcull marks a bounce as permanent?**

Mailcull, our email bounce processor, classifies hard bounces after three consecutive failures and suppresses the address automatically. Soft bounces are retried for 72 hours. If the suppression list itself becomes corrupted, restore it from the encrypted nightly snapshot in the Thornfield backup bucket. Restoring requires the team recovery passphrase, which is kept directly below this entry for emergencies.

unlock words, kahof-bahap: praax-ulaix

Symptoms: rising open-socket churn, stable message throughput, and handshake latency climbing past two seconds. Mitigation: enable server-side jitter injection and raise the per-IP reconnect ceiling temporarily, then roll the affected client cohort. Do not restart the gateway; sessions will resubscribe safely. The gateway currently runs with the following configuration.

service settings:
PRAIX_LOG_LEVEL=error
PRAIX_METRICS_HOST=metrics.praix.qorvelcorp.corp
PRAIX_POOL_SIZE=16